From: Thomas Huth <thuth@redhat.com>
Some kernel code needs to zeroize their local hmac_sha1_ctx structures
after use to avoid leaking sensitive material on the stack.
Provide an hmac_sha1_zeroize_ctx() helper that can be used with __cleanup()
to automatically zeroize the context when it goes out of scope.
Signed-off-by: Thomas Huth <thuth@redhat.com>
---
include/crypto/sha1.h | 17 +++++++++++++++++
1 file changed, 17 insertions(+)
diff --git a/include/crypto/sha1.h b/include/crypto/sha1.h
index 4d973e016cd69..888dfc62e1c65 100644
--- a/include/crypto/sha1.h
+++ b/include/crypto/sha1.h
@@ -7,6 +7,7 @@
#define _CRYPTO_SHA1_H
#include <linux/types.h>
+#include <linux/string.h>
#define SHA1_DIGEST_SIZE 20
#define SHA1_BLOCK_SIZE 64
@@ -106,6 +107,22 @@ struct hmac_sha1_ctx {
struct sha1_block_state ostate;
};
+/**
+ * hmac_sha1_zeroize_ctx() - Zeroize a hmac_sha1_ctx structure
+ * @ctx: The location of the context that should be zeroized
+ *
+ * This function explicitly fills the hmac_sha1_ctx with zeroes. For
+ * example, it can be used with __cleanup() for local hmac_sha1_ctx
+ * structures on the stack, so that their content is not leaked via the
+ * stack when the context is left. Note: This is only required when not
+ * using hmac_sha1_final() that already zeroizes the structure at the
+ * end.
+ */
+static inline void hmac_sha1_zeroize_ctx(struct hmac_sha1_ctx *ctx)
+{
+ memzero_explicit(ctx, sizeof(*ctx));
+}
+
/**
* hmac_sha1_preparekey() - Prepare a key for HMAC-SHA1
* @key: (output) the key structure to initialize

From: Thomas Huth <thuth@redhat.com>
Clear the hmac_sha1_ctx structure via __cleanup(hmac_sha1_zeroize_ctx)
to make sure that the function cannot leak any sensitive data on the
stack in case we return without hmac_sha1_final() here.
Signed-off-by: Thomas Huth <thuth@redhat.com>
---
security/keys/trusted-keys/trusted_tpm1.c | 2 +-
1 file changed, 1 insertion(+), 1 deletion(-)
diff --git a/security/keys/trusted-keys/trusted_tpm1.c b/security/keys/trusted-keys/trusted_tpm1.c
index 13513819991e7..90536ae53d4a8 100644
--- a/security/keys/trusted-keys/trusted_tpm1.c
+++ b/security/keys/trusted-keys/trusted_tpm1.c
@@ -102,7 +102,7 @@ static inline void dump_tpm_buf(unsigned char *buf)
static int TSS_rawhmac(unsigned char *digest, const unsigned char *key,
unsigned int keylen, ...)
{
- struct hmac_sha1_ctx hmac_ctx;
+ struct hmac_sha1_ctx hmac_ctx __cleanup(hmac_sha1_zeroize_ctx);
va_list argp;
unsigned int dlen;
unsigned char *data;

As you probably know, SHA-1 is a bit outdated. Will these be coming for
SHA-2 as well? It would be nice to introduce all the APIs at the same
time so that we can make sure they're consistent. I would actually
prioritize that over introducing callers of them right now, as that can
be done later and often requires acks from other maintainers (and they
can go through other trees as well).
